Step-by-Step Pressure Testing Process
Start by ensuring the engine is cool, then remove the radiator cap and install the correct adapter. Attach the pressure tester pump and apply the recommended pressure (usually 15-18 PSI). Monitor the gauge for 10-15 minutes—if the pressure drops, you have a leak.
Key Tips for Accurate Leak Detection
These simple tips will help you get reliable results every time you use your pressure tester.
- Use the Correct Adapter for Your Vehicle’s Radiator Cap
- Pressurize to the System’s Rated Pressure, Not Maximum
- Check All Components (Hoses, Heater Core, Water Pump) for Leaks
